A.G. Barr, the company behind popular brands like IRN-BRU, Rubicon, and Funkin, has reported a strong first-half performance in line with board expectations. Revenue for the period ending July 27 is anticipated to be around £221 million ($284.2 million), up from £210.4 million in the same period last year. The growth was driven by its soft drinks segment, which saw a revenue increase of approximately 7%. A.G. Barr’s CEO Euan Sutherland stated that they remain committed to improving profit margins, leading to positive earnings momentum for the second half and beyond. The company maintains its forecast for fiscal 2024, expecting to deliver revenue and pretax profit in line with market expectations.
